+ | HMS ''Druid'' represents a hypothetical design for a “Super Daring”-class of destroyer that was considered during the early 1950s. British experience with the ''Tribal''-class destroyers had shown the value of large destroyers with a heavy gun armament, which could be capable of fulfilling some of the traditional cruiser roles. | |||

+ | <h4>Historical Background</h4> | |||
+ | The “Super Daring” idea evolved from British studies into creating a new type of multipurpose escort ship. The emergence of the Soviet ''Sverdlov''-class cruisers and the need for shore bombardment during the Korean War meant that gun ships were still needed by the Royal Navy, in addition to ASW vessels. The Royal Navy’s surviving ''Town''- and ''Crown Colony''-class cruisers would require extensive modernization, in order to deal with the rapidly evolving aerial threats. Although it was realised that missiles would form the mainstay of future anti-aircraft defences, the British SeaSlug system was too large to fit onto contemporary destroyer-sized vessels, and the cost of fully modernizing a cruiser was prohibitive in the post-war economic climate. | |||
+ | ||||
+ | Initially, plans were drawn up for a modernized version of the ''Daring''-class destroyer, as it was felt that two ''Daring''-class destroyers would be able to successfully combat a ''Sverdlov''-class cruiser through the weight of gunfire, whilst closing to launch torpedoes. Initial designs included a repeat version of the ''Daring''-class with minimal modifications, as well as proposed variants with improved propulsion plants. From June 1954, designs for a “Fast A/S” escort were drawn up. The possible designs rapidly changed as specifications were drawn up and found to be unattainable. | |||
+ | ||||
+ | The list of desired characteristics included a good surface combat capability, long-range ASW detection and attack, and anti-aircraft defences. When the specifications were examined, it was realised that the requirements would be impossible to achieve on a ''Daring'' hull, due to space, displacement, and electrical capacity. It was estimated that the desired characteristics would require a minimum displacement of 5,000 tons, making the ship the same size as a ''Dido'' cruiser, but with no armor protection. The ship would be too large to be unprotected, but adding sufficient armor protection would increase displacement further, making the ship too large. As a result, further versions of the design were considered, which removed equipment in order to bring the displacement within acceptable limits. | |||
+ | ||||
+ | By 1955, a “gun fast escort” design of 4,500 tons had been developed, featuring 114 mm guns at the expense of all ASW weapons. Although the intended 127 mm N2 gun design had been cancelled, there was still hope that a simpler 127 mm twin gun mount could still be developed. Eventually, plans for a “Super Daring” moved on. A larger design of 4,800 tons was requested, and this would eventually lead to the ''County''-class missile destroyer. | |||

Druid — British special premium Tier X destroyer.
After giving the green light to the construction of Daring-class ships, the Admiralty soon came to realize that their combat characteristics would not allow them to counter the new American and Soviet destroyers as equals. During the first half of the 1950s, design work commenced on ships that would be capable of opposing Project 68-bis cruisers owing to their new rapid-firing guns. These ships were also meant to serve as escorts for aircraft carrier groups and convoys, as well as to hunt down enemy submarines. While the project never reached the design drawing stage, the drafts were used as a basis for the project to build County-class guided missile destroyers.

Druid is a British Tier X destroyer armed with dual-purpose 127 mm gun mounts. Despite lacking torpedoes, she poses a significant threat to other ships due to the rapid rate of fire of her main battery guns. In addition, her anti-aircraft armament creates an effective defense against attacking aircraft.
Fully specialized for concealment, Druid has a somewhat high detectability range, meaning that Druid will often be spotted first in an engagement. Players must account for enemy destroyers with lower detectability ranges that will expose them in a flanking maneuver. In an engagement, Druid excels at punishing enemy destroyers foolish enough to show their broadside. Armed only with armor-piercing (AP) shells, Druid may have trouble penetrating the armored hulls of angled ships. In a scenario where a ship is running from an engagement or turning, players should aim for the superstructure to increase the likelihood of an effective penetrating hit. If players find themselves in a predicament, Druid is armed with a long-lasting Short-Range Hydro-Acoustic Search consumable as well as a Short-Burst Smoke Generator
. Although a bit limited in their function, they may be just enough to help the player avoid torpedoes or break line of sight with an enemy to return to concealment or briefly engage from the smokescreen. Perhaps the most useful consumable is her Repair Party
. Druid is equipped with a decent repair party that can help her recover hit points after taking damage in a fight, increasing her usefulness and longevity in gameplay. Both of her gun mounts are located in a forward-facing configuration, leaving her stern unprotected when running or facing away from enemy ships.

Druid is one of a limited number of destroyers with access to the Repair Party consumable. The Short-Burst Smoke Generator
gives players the opportunity to break line of sight with the enemy and return to concealment in the smokescreen, as long as no enemy ship has used Surveillance Radar
or Hydroacoustic Search
within its respective range of Druid. The smoke generator on Druid provides a small smokescreen that lasts less than a minute. The reload time is quick, allowing for smokescreens to be produced in rapid succession with a short period of time where Druid is exposed. This consumable is particularly effective when playing aggressively, as it may be deployed when Druid ventures too close to enemies, or in a situation where she is being targeted by multiple ships. The very limited range of her Short-Range Hydro-Acoustic Search
means that it will mostly be effective for spotting torpedoes while in smoke.
